Time the record covers

At least 21 million years on record.

The record covers at least 83.6 Mya to 61.66 Mya. No occurrence read is dated outside 85.7 Mya to 56 Mya.

34 occurrences of Cunnolites polymorphus on record, most of them in the Late Cretaceous. Bar height is expected occurrences, not a count: each fossil is spread across the span it is dated to, so a tall narrow bar means tight dating and a low wide one means loose.

Found in

5 formations

Aruma — 25.45°N, 46.53°EAruma — 25.17°N, 46.88°EAruma — 25.62°N, 46.37°EAruma — 25.93°N, 45.78°EZongshan — 27.48°N, 88.90°EVallcarga — 42.25°N, 0.97°ESimsima — 25.02°N, 55.78°EHochmoos — 47.57°N, 13.50°E

The named rock units Cunnolites polymorphus has been recovered from, largest first. Drawn where the rock is now, not where it formed. 25 occurrences have no formation on record, which is common for older literature.
